273. Give the electronic configurations of oxygen and sulfur, chromium and molybdenum atoms. Why do chromium and molybdenum have electronic configurations in the ground state (n-1)d5ns1 and not (n-1)d4ns2 ? How does the stability of the highest oxidation state change for the elements of the main and secondary subgroups from top to bottom?
